What will the apprentice be doing?
The purpose of this role is to be a key contact providing administrative support to the general office. The apprentice will be required to assist with the customer experience and provide administration assistance.
Key responsibilities:
- Provide support that includes the recording of customer queries and/or contacting customers
- Politely and professionally answer phone calls and direct them effectively taking messages where necessary and ensure these are passed to the relevant member of staff
- Meet and greet visitors in the head office, offering and making refreshments accordingly
- Assist with distribution of incoming and outgoing post on a daily basis (including weekly site post) and occasional trips to the post office for special/recorded items
- Provide additional administration support to the general office
- Filing
- Scanning
- Provide the highest level of customer service support to the business
- Customer interactions within the role will cover a wide range of situations including telephone, post and email
